The canon of the Pokémon anime consists of the following: The events of each and every episode are canon, and occur in chronological order with the exception of EP052, which takes place before EP049. Canon - Another word for official. Canon, in terms of fictional stories, refers to what is considered to be an official part of the main storyline. It typically means that the episode has some content in it that’s out of the manga, but also contains anime-only scenes. For example, the final episode of the original Naruto series concludes a filler-arc the anime was doing, but after that wraps up the end of the episode shows the canon events of Naruto leaving the village at the end of part 1.
